Edgewater Technical Associates is seeking qualified candidates for a Solutions Architect 3 (Azure) opportunity in Los Alamos, NM to support the Los Alamos National Laboratory.
Citizenship: United States Citizenship is required.
Work Location: The work location for this position is Remote.
Clearance: No Clearance requirements for this position.
Summary:
You will be responsible for developing, implementing, and maintaining automated guardrails for cloud environments on Microsoft Azure. Your role will involve ensuring that all cloud resources, workloads, and processes comply with company policies, security frameworks, and industry regulations, while optimizing for cost-efficiency, scalability, and performance. You will work closely with DevOps, Cloud Architects, Security teams, and other stakeholders to establish and enforce guardrails that prevent misconfigurations, mitigate risks, and promote best practices for cloud-native applications.

WORKING WITH EDGEWATER TECHNICAL ASSOCIATES
Founded in 2003, Edgewater Technical Associates, LLC (Edgewater) is a New Mexico-based small business headquartered in Los Alamos, NM, with five (5) regional offices across the United States to locally support our growing presence at project sites. Edgewater has a proven track record and is a trusted provider of fixed-price construction projects, engineering, and technical services for the Department of Energy (DOE), National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C), Canadian Commercial Nuclear Industry, and private sector commercial contractors involved in nuclear, high-hazard, or complex operations.
